HG, a self-proclaimed “nerd” with a penchant for technology, shared their top travel essentials, highlighting a travel plug with USB-C as a must-have. This practical item allows for simultaneous charging of multiple devices, a crucial convenience for modern travelers.
Beyond technology, HG emphasized the importance of a “sleep pack” comprising an eye mask, earplugs, and melatonin. This trio is designed to aid in rapid acclimatization to new time zones, a common challenge for frequent flyers. The ability to quickly adjust to local sleeping patterns can significantly enhance the travel experience and combat jet lag.

When asked about packing habits, HG expressed a preference for carry-on only travel whenever feasible, aiming to expedite the airport exit process. However, they acknowledged the practicality of checking a bag for extended trips, particularly when visiting destinations like Japan.For such journeys, HG recommended a hard-shell suitcase with an expandable zipper, anticipating the need to bring back souvenirs or additional items.
